Hotel operator Schulte Hospitality Group has appointed Sanjhi Agrawal as EVP, operations accounting and finance.

Agrawal brings more than 15 years of finance experience to the role and will oversee the company’s hotel accounting and finance functions, including accounting operations, reporting, accounts payable, tax and internal audit teams. She will work closely with operations teams and ownership groups on financial controls, reporting and portfolio performance initiatives across the company’s portfolio of some 250 hotels globally.

Most recently, Agrawal led a 150-person global finance organization at Eaton Corporation, where she integrated planning, analytics, and automation into a unified operating model. Earlier in her career, she held senior finance and controllership positions at Brown-Forman Corporation, overseeing areas including accounting and reporting, global treasury, mergers and acquisitions and financial planning and analysis. 

Agrawal will report to Brian Fitzgerald, who joined the Louisville, Ky.-based company as CFO late last year as Schulte Hospitality continues investing in its finance and operations infrastructure.

“Sanjhi brings deep accounting, treasury and enterprise finance experience across complex, global environments,” Fitzgerald said in a statement. “She has a strong track record of modernizing accounting and reporting processes, improving forecasting discipline with advanced automation tools and designing operating models that support scale while maintaining rigor. I’m excited for her to elevate our finance organization as we continue to grow.”
